This so users can come online directly with the correct vhost set,
and not first with a standard (usually cloaked) host while auto-(re-)joining
followed by a CHGHOST later.
This is a long outstanding wish from users, I think.
Services can simply send a CHGHOST/CHGIDENT to the UID, for example
right before they send the SASL ... D S message (SASL succeeded)
they can send like: CHGHOST 002ABCDEF some.nice.host
Then UnrealIRCd 6.0.7-git and later will handle the CHGHOST even if
the user is not known yet. Technically, the server where the UID is
on will handle the message. And remote servers that don't know the
user with this UID yet will forward to the server with the SID-portion
of the UID. The CHGHOST will not be a broadcast but the vhost will
show up in the UID protocol message that introduces the user.
For CHGIDENT it is a similar story.
Light testing has been done but more extensive testing is welcomed.

"./unrealircd reloadtls" and there is now also a "./unrealircd status"
The output is colorized if the terminal supports it (just like on the
boot screen) and also the exit status is 0 for success and non-0 for
failure. The purpose of all this is that you can easily detect rehash
errors on the command line.
These three commands communicate to UnrealIRCd via the new control
UNIX socket, which is in ~/data/unrealircd.ctl.
This also does a lot of other stuff because we now have an internal
tool called bin/unrealircdctl which is called by ./unrealircd for
some of the commands to communicate to the unrealircd.ctl socket.
Later on more of the existing functionality may be moved to that
tool and we may also provide it on Windows in CLI mode so people
have more of the same functionality as on *NIX.

Rename client->srvptr to client->uplink: this is the uplink that the client
is connected to. If the client is a user then it is set to the server that
the client is connected to, if the client is a server then it is set to the
server that the server is connected to (the.. tadah.. uplink).
For local clients it is always set to &me.

code changes in UnrealIRCd itself:
1) Clients are no longer freed directly by exit_client. Most fields
are freed, but 'sptr' itself is not, so you can use IsDead() on it.
2) exit_client now returns void rather than int
3) ALL command functions return void rather than int.
Of course this also affects do_cmd, command overrides, etc.
This is a direct consequence of the removal of 'cptr' earlier, as that
was used to signal certain things that are now no longer possible
(and it raises the question if things were always correctly signaled
in the first place, so may fix some bugs).
It also makes the code more resillient against cases where you forgot
to check if the client was freed. Still, you are encouraged to do an
IsDead(sptr) if you are calling functions that may kill clients,
such as command functions or things that may use spamfilter.
More changes will follow, such as the removal of FLUSH_BUFFER.
